What is louisiana annual reconciliation form

The Louisiana Annual Reconciliation Form L-3 is a state tax document used by employers to reconcile and report withholding tax remitted to the Louisiana Department of Revenue for a specific tax year.

What is the Louisiana Annual Reconciliation Form L-3?

The Louisiana Annual Reconciliation Form L-3 serves a critical role for employers in Louisiana as it is used to reconcile the withholding tax submitted to the Louisiana Department of Revenue. This form includes essential details like the tax period covered and the number of W-2s attached, which are significant for accurate reporting.
Importantly, signing the Louisiana withholding tax form L-3 carries legal implications. Employers must acknowledge that the information provided is true and correct, as any discrepancies can lead to penalties.

Who Needs the Louisiana Annual Reconciliation Form L-3?

The Louisiana Annual Reconciliation Form L-3 must be filed by any taxpayer classified as an employer who has withheld state income tax from employee wages. This includes businesses across various sectors with employees who receive W-2s.
Common scenarios necessitating the filing of this form include having multiple employees or operating a business that withholds state taxes, thereby requiring compliance with Louisiana tax laws.

When to File the Louisiana Annual Reconciliation Form L-3?

The due date for submitting Form L-3 is set within 30 days after the last month wages were paid during the tax year. Late submission may incur penalties, making it imperative for employers to mark this deadline on their calendars.
Taxpayers should allocate sufficient time to prepare and submit the form, particularly considering the details that must be accurately gathered from employee records to fulfill reporting requirements.

Common Errors and How to Avoid Them When Filing the Louisiana Annual Reconciliation Form L-3

Taxpayers often face issues due to several common errors when filing Form L-3. Frequent mistakes include mismatched totals and incomplete fields. Recognizing these errors in advance can help mitigate problems.
Additional checks before submission are crucial. Review all entries thoroughly to ensure accuracy, as this step reinforces the importance of delivering a complete and correct form.

Submission Methods for the Louisiana Annual Reconciliation Form L-3

Employers have several submission options for the Louisiana Annual Reconciliation Form L-3. These methods include:
  • Online submission through the Louisiana Department of Revenue portal.
  • Mailing the completed form directly to the appropriate office.
Additionally, employers should be aware of possible fees associated with certain submission methods and look for delivery confirmation to ensure successful receipt of their filing.

This form is specifically for employers in Louisiana who must report withholding tax, especially those who have issued W-2s for their employees during the tax year.
The Louisiana Annual Reconciliation Form L-3 must be submitted within 30 days after the last month wages were paid. Ensure timely submission to avoid penalties.
Once completed, the form can be submitted electronically through pdfFiller or printed and mailed to the Louisiana Department of Revenue as per their submission guidelines.
When submitting the L-3 form, you typically need to include copies of W-2 forms, which detail the tax amounts withheld for each employee throughout the year.
Common mistakes include entering incorrect tax figures, forgetting to sign the form, and not including all W-2s. Double-check all entries for accuracy.
Processing times for the Louisiana Annual Reconciliation Form L-3 vary, but it typically takes several weeks. Check for updates with the Louisiana Department of Revenue.
If you find mistakes after submission, you may need to submit an amended form or contact the Louisiana Department of Revenue for guidance on how to correct inaccuracies.
